10TH NASS REPORT CARD: North-central Reps sponsor 146 bills in first year

North-central lawmakers in the 10th House of Representatives have made significant contributions in their first year, sponsoring a total of 146 bills  From June 2023 to May 2024, representatives from the north-central zone demonstrated their commitment to legislative duties by sponsoring 146 bills, which represent 12.4 percent of all bills introduced in the house. Senate re-introduces south-south development commission bill

While the NDDC addresses the Niger Delta oil producing region in a broad sense, the South-South Development Commission will hone in on the specific developmental, economic, and ecological challenges facing the South South. The senate has passed for second reading, a bill seeking to establish the South-South Development Commission. FRA: Reps consolidate six fiscal bills 

The House of Representatives has consolidated six Fiscal Responsibility Act (FRA) amendment bills. It is expected that the House will reintroduce the consolidated bill for second reading soon The House of Representatives on Thursday consolidated six Fiscal Responsibility Act (FRA) amendment bills. Senate steps down bill to prescribe licence for private investigators

Oshiomhole noted that the bill will lead to a licence for extortion and blackmail and it will end up being uncontrollable. The senate has stepped down a bill seeking to prescribe standard and conditions of licence for operation and practice of private investigators in the country.
